Fred Hueston, the founder of Stone Forensics and a seasoned expert in stone and tile restoration, has released his deeply personal and inspiring memoir, My Heart Journey: Waiting on a Heart. This book offers a raw, honest, and often humorous account of Hueston’s experience waiting for a heart transplant, shedding light on the emotional and physical journey he navigated during one of the most challenging times of his life.
Hueston’s story is not just about the medical procedures or the statistics of heart transplantation. Rather, it is a heartfelt exploration of the daily struggles, triumphs, and emotional challenges that come with such a life-altering experience. Drawing on his professional background, Hueston offers a fresh perspective on resilience, humor, and the unspoken joys of the recovery process. His unflinching honesty and lighthearted approach make his book stand out in the genre of transplant memoirs, making it a must-read for anyone interested in the human side of medical recovery.
“My Heart Journey: Waiting on a Heart” takes readers inside the hospital room and beyond, sharing the small moments of joy, the battles with doubt, and the simple victories that made each day feel meaningful. From the first steps down the hallway to the unforgettable reunion with his loyal dog, Honey, after 80 days apart, Hueston’s narrative is infused with the grit and grace that defined his journey.
